Q: How long does it take to ship a vehicle?
A: Transit times depend a lot on the miles between your pickup location and your destination. The average transit times within 48 contiguous states is 2-7 days. Transit times are estimates of how long your move may take. Several factors affect your actual transit time including, but not limited to weather, traffic, road construction, and the priority of vehicles accompanying yours during transit.
Q: How do I prepare my vehicle for transport?
A: Here are the basics:
- Your vehicle should be clean for inspection at the beginning of your move
- You or your designated representative must be present at the time of pickup, and are responsible for signing the inspection report at both pickup and delivery.
- Advise EZ Transport of any modifications made to your vehicle.
- Make sure you have a phone number where you may be reached throughout the duration of your vehicle relocation.
- Remove all personal belonging from your vehicle
- Your vehicle can't have any obvious fluid leaks
- Alarm systems must be disconnected, disabled, or turned off
- Items that should be removed: wide mirrors, antenna (if possible), any loose parts or specialty items, your toll tag or E-Z pass, all exterior spare tire covers, grill covers, and non-permanent luggage, bike, or ski racks.
- Repair or seal any tears or open seams on convertible tops to prevent fast-moving air from causing further damage
Q. What is an oversize fee?
A: Some vehicles are much larger than traditional passenger vehicles. Most full size SUVs fit in to this category. Because of the extraordinary dimensions, these vehicles take up the amount of space normally used for two vehicles, thus resulting in an "oversize" fee.
Q: Can I ship personal items in my vehicle?
A: No. All personal items must be removed from the vehicle before shipping. We recommend that you ship your personal items via FedEx, UPS, or USPS. Under NO circumstances can the car contain firearms, hazardous materials, illegal substances, or contraband. EZ Transport Corp is not responsible for any personal items accidentally or intentionally left in your vehicle or for damage these items cause to your vehicle.
